Abstract: This article examines the forces acting on the structure and the dynamic characteristics of structures when calculating underground tunnel structures. To calculate underground tunnel structures, a number of countries around the world used the spectral curve method [1,2]. Based on this method, regulatory documents have been developed [3,4,5]. To calculate seismic loads, it is necessary to know the dynamic characteristics of the structure: frequencies and forms of natural oscillations and attenuation parameters.
